RECAP: FLAMES WOMEN VS WEST HERTS WARRIORS

West Herts beats Coventry 54-34

The Coventry Flames debut performance in the WNBL pit the home team against the visiting West Herts Warriors, which ended in a 54-34 win for the visitors. West Herts' stifling defense held Coventry to less than 30% shooting from the field, whilst scoring 21 of their 54 points from behind the 3-point line. 

After a slow first quarter from the Flames that saw them down 17-9, the women rallied using a strong defensive quarter to limit the Warriors to single digit scoring in the second frame. However, the visitors emerged from the locker room after half time with renewed energy and held the Flames to 4 points in the third quarter, putting the game out of reach for Coventry.

Speaking honestly about the game, Flames guard, Sara Benavente, said "I think it was an expected result as it was our first time playing at that level and as a new team." Remaining optimistic about the season, Benavente added, "We can only go up from [here] and we'll do so. It just feels good to be back on court and I'm really grateful to be able to play with [this team]."

Benavente and Catarina Seixas both led the team in scoring, chipping in 10 points each in the loss. 

MVP: Sara Benavente earned MVP honors for her 10point, 7 rebound and 14 steal outing, tallying her first double-double of the season.

Up Next: Flames Women will travel to Cardiff next weekend to take on a tough Cardiff Met Archers II on Saturday 16th October. The game will tip at 1pm.
